Un software robusto con cientos de pruebas automatizadas, un código fuente limpio y un bajo porcentaje de "bugs" o errores, los cuales se corrigen sin costo alguno gracias a nuestra garantía de 3 meses.
Play
"Baja y conoce la profundidad de nuestro proceso."
5. Producción
La puesta en producción significa instalar la app en ambiente estable y NO controlado por el equipo de desarrollo.
Esto es muy importante, pues si necesitas realizar más "demos", lo recomendable es no hacerlas cuando la app o el desarrollo pase a la etapa de producción. Sin embargo, si quieres utilizar pruebas en tu app cuando esté en ambiente estable, debes tener en cuenta que el producto final se va a demorar más tiempo y posiblemente, consumirás más horas de las previstas.
4. Testing
En el caso de estar desarrollando una app, es esencial que la vayas probando antes que ésta pase a producción. Para esto, utilizamos Firebase y TestFlight, para hacerte llegar siempre la última versión.
El problema más recurrente es que el cliente no siempre está probando la versión final. Esto se corrige al borrar la app antes enviada y descargando la última entrega.
Debido a la anterior, te enviaremos siempre un instructivo adicional con las indicaciones de cómo probar la app versión final.
Nuestro forma de trabajo se basa en metodología ágil, específicamente en el
proceso Scrum.
3. Desarrollo
Nuestros desarrolladores, se encargan de la interfaz de la app, desde el punto de vista del código, utilizando tecnologías tales como Ionic, Cordova, Typescript, Angular y herramientas como Android Studio y Xcode, y en el caso de desarrollos web usan tecnologías como Angular, HTML, Typescript, Javascript entre otros.
Semanalmente planificamos las tareas de cada proyecto, según las necesidades de nuestros clientes.
2. Diseño
Nuestros diseñadores están presentes desde el inicio del proyecto, dando forma a los requerimientos e iterando contigo para ir dando forma a cada desarrollo. Para esto, usamos herramientas de prototipado (Figma, Adobe, Scketch) mediante las cuales puedes ver en todo momento los cambios y mejoras que se irán acordando.
Además, la experiencia de usuario es muy importante para nosotros, por lo que dentro del área de diseño, contamos con diseñadores UX. Nuestros diseñadores UX, fundamentan su trabajo en la metodología Design Thinking.
Presentamos avances periódicos para recibir aprobaciones, comentarios o modificaciones. Es fundamental el trabajo recíproco.
1. Definición
También conocido como Sprint 0, es un entregable que, por lo general, toma más tiempo que las otras etapas. Aquí se define el alcance ideal de todo el proyecto, en el cual el equipo de desarrollo calcula el esfuerzo de cada una de las tareas y así, disminuir los posibles riesgos de las siguientes etapas.
Nuestra estrategia es adaptable, de acuerdo a los requerimientos del cliente y es flexible al considerar los cambios solicitados.